Perfect for professionals or students, this spacious split-level three-bedroom apartment is set across the first and second floors of a charming 1930s semi-detached home on a quiet residential street in Cricklewood. The property features a bright and spacious open-plan living and dining area with wooden flooring, high ceilings, and large windows that fill the home with natural light. The contemporary kitchen is well presented and opens directly onto a generous private decked terrace, creating an excellent space for relaxing or entertaining. The principal bedroom benefits from extensive fitted wardrobes, while the second double bedroom also offers built-in storage. On the upper floor, a large loft room provides flexible accommodation, ideal as a third bedroom, home office, or guest suite, complete with built-in storage, an en-suite shower room, and a rooflight. Additional benefits include a family bathroom with both a bath and separate shower, excellent storage throughout, off-street parking, and a practical layout suited to modern living. Cricklewood combines the convenience of city living with the feel of a well-established residential neighbourhood. The apartment is just a five-minute walk from Cricklewood Thameslink Station, offering direct services to King’s Cross in approximately 18 minutes. Brent Cross Shopping Centre, local cafés, restaurants, and everyday amenities are all within easy reach, while Hampstead Heath and nearby parks provide excellent green space.
